Transaction 450337623cb6385df1c6563339e487171c5a38b2ec38db368816da3fe66d4a14
1 Input
1 Output
-
450337623cb6385df1c6563339e487171c5a38b2ec38db368816da3fe66d4a14:0
- value
- 15181124
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5fcbe676e50c670b0d143a0f5eb8b1ac255567966c7c7f24dc6caecb2a5fa214
- address
- bc1ptl97vah9p3nskrg58g84aw934sj42eukd3787fxudjhvk2jl5g2qm7glhn